Rainbow Children Community Pre School in Stanwell, Staines, TW19 7EE, is a childcare setting established in 2000. Operating from a purpose-built building within the grounds of St David's Roman Catholic Church, the pre-school provides a friendly and secure environment where children aged two to four are settled and happy.
The dedicated team of seven staff, five of whom hold early years qualifications, ensures children increase their confidence, explore the environment, and make their own choices. The pre-school fosters positive relationships among children and staff, with all children demonstrating that they feel safe and secure.
Children are encouraged to be curious and engage in imaginative play, supported by thoughtfully provided resources and activities that cater to their interests. The curriculum, developed by the manager, is based on children's interests and covers all areas of learning, including strong support for children with special educational needs and/or disabilities (SEND).

Inclusion & environment
Children with special educational needs and/or disabilities (SEND) are supported to a high level. Staff work closely with parents and external agencies to ensure the best outcomes, with specific training provided to support individual needs.
Children have ample opportunities to develop their larger muscles, enjoying exploring and running around with friends. Younger children develop their confidence as they learn to climb and ride bikes with help if needed.
